I`m trying to record gameplay using msi afterburner on witcher 3 with reshade enable, and using nvenc but it records without reshade.
I tried with shadowplay and it records with reshade just fine.
Is there some settings I`m missing?
I could use shadowplay but I think afterburner encoding is better
It's a gamble whether another injector hooks before or after ReShade. You got lucky with Shadowplay, not so much with Afterburner. There isn't anything to be done, you just have to use Shadowplay I'm afraid.
Try OBS (Open Broadcaster Software):
obsproject.com/
It works fine for me in almost every game, even when using ReShade.
If you can't record the game, record the whole monitor instead.
You can use NVENC or QuickSync, or just old x264.